Job Description

The Medical Officer will be the senior physician in the market for both Adventist Health White Memorial, and Adventist Health White Memorial Montebello.

Job Summary:

Serves as the senior physician leader in the market, with the role spanning medical and clinical staff alignment and engagement, market strategy, and finance and operations-related topics. Leads the organization to bring the clinical voice forward, be the patient advocate, acts as a subject matter expert for clinical staff and administration, and oversees care transformation initiatives directed by clinical cabinets. Leads the roll out of local initiatives within the market, and ensures the overall continuous quality improvement of care delivery. Mentors and develops the existing and future physician and clinical leadership across the market. Provides strategic and operational direction for the delivery of clinical care in close partnership with key clinical and operational leaders to ensure the highest level of patient safety and care.

About Adventist Health System Sunbelt, Inc

Adventist Health System Sunbelt, Inc. is a non-profit healthcare organization that operates hospitals and other healthcare facilities in the southern United States. The organization is affiliated with the Seventh-day Adventist Church and is one of the largest non-profit healthcare providers in the country. Adventist Health System Sunbelt, Inc. was founded in 1973 and is headquartered in Altamonte Springs, Florida.
